Early Years Learning Through Nature
Our nursery and pre-school visits introduce children to animals in a gentle and reassuring way. Children are encouraged to observe, talk about, and—where appropriate—carefully interact with the animals, helping them develop an early understanding of the natural world.
Our sessions support EYFS areas including:
- Understanding the World – The Natural World
- Personal, Social and Emotional Development
- Communication and Language
Animal encounters help children learn new vocabulary, practise listening and turn-taking, and develop respect for living things. For many children, meeting animals for the first time is a memorable and confidence-building experience.

Safe, Gentle and Fully Supervised Visits
All nursery and pre-school visits are delivered with the highest standards of safety, hygiene, and animal welfare. Animals are carefully selected for their suitability for early years environments, and all interaction is closely supervised.
Emily’s Mini Farm provides:
- Full public liability insurance
- Written risk assessments for all activities
- A comprehensive animal health and welfare policy
- Clear handwashing and hygiene procedures
- DBS-checked staff
- Defined supervision ratios
- Emergency procedures in place at every visit
We manage all aspects of animal care, setup, and supervision, allowing nursery staff to focus on supporting children and enjoying the experience alongside them.
